Verbal Ability
Civil Services Aptitude Test (CSAT) is an integral component of UPSC recruitment. It assesses candidates’ general aptitude and mental ability, verifying whether they possess necessary administrative roles skills. CSAT also helps eliminate those not sufficiently prepared by eliminating those not fully ready. Preparation can be daunting; success lies in taking an organized, consistent, self-evaluative approach towards this examination.
As part of your reading comprehension preparation, read newspapers, editorials and weekly magazines regularly. Doing this will expand your vocabulary and English and reduce time spent understanding each comprehension statement – speeding up answering time in the exam itself! Additionally, solve 20-30 previous year CAT passages to strengthen comprehension abilities further.
Logical reasoning and analytical ability are also integral parts of CSAT preparation, so staying abreast of current affairs as well as practicing puzzles and brain teasers to strengthen these abilities are also vital.
